Jun 302017
Spain has well recognized the foreign policy of Sri Lanka and it has helped much to strengthen diplomatic ties between Spain and Sri Lanka, says …
Spain has well recognized the foreign policy of Sri Lanka and it has helped much to strengthen diplomatic ties between Spain and Sri Lanka, says …